Transaction 8700311910c39835b8a8ff6a8e26d538802c395e9211c4da758241611dc54c14
1 Input
1 Output
-
8700311910c39835b8a8ff6a8e26d538802c395e9211c4da758241611dc54c14:0
- value
- 1639300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 446579792e6219e48ee595e4928730cf58ad78b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17EeWcmbGTkqodLHVNRDXjs9H2N2iZDLeW